ON HEAT OR MASS TRANSFER BETWEEN THE FLUIDIZING AGENT AND THE SOLID PARTICLES OF THE FLUIDIZED BED (in Rumanian)
BS>The problem of heat or mass transfer between the fluidizing agent and the solid particles is examined, both in the case of homogeneous fluidization and in that of nonhomogeneous fluidization. In the first case the experimental results are correlated, by using,the following equations Nu =0.426 Re/sup 0.30/ Ar/sup 0.17/ Pr/sup 1/3/ for Re Ar/sup -0.40/ <2.15 and Nu = 0.943 Re/sup -1/ Ar/ sup 0.69/ Pr/sup 1/3/ for Re Ar/sup -0.40/> 2.15, where Nu, Re, Ar, and Pr are Nusselt's, Reynolds', Archimedes', and Prandtl' s numbers. Nu, Re, and Ar numbers are computed with the diameter of the particle. In the second case, of non-homogeneous fluidization, the problem of the adequate definition of the transfer coefficient is discussed and the reason why small values are obtained for the transfer coefficients, such as they are defined in the literature, is explained.
